Checkpoint Molecules Predict Response to Immunotherapy in Cancer
cells

Heij et al. investigated the expression of checkpoint molecules in the tumor microenvironment of intrahepatic cholangio-carcinoma. They found that co-expression patterns of checkpoint molecules such as PD-L1 and TIGIT correlate with metastases and poor prognosis. TissueFAXS and StrataQuest were used to image the mIF-stained samples and assess protein expression.

Community-developed checklists for publishing images and image analyses
Nature Methods

QUAREP-LiMi is an initiative focused on promoting quality assessment and reproducibility for instruments and images in light microscopy. Dr. Rupert Ecker, CEO of TissueGnostics, participated in developing standardized guidelines for best practices in image communication. These checklists offer key recommendations on image formatting and annotation among others.

AI-Assisted Analysis of ‘Anti-/Pro-Tumor’ Profiles for Pancreatic Adenocarcinoma
Cancer Biology & Medicine

To predict survival of patients with pancreatic adenocarcinoma, Zhou et al. performed an AI-assisted comprehensive analysis of CD8+ T cells, cancer stem cells (CSCs), and tumor budding (TB). They used StrataQuest image analysis software to automatically detect and quantify tumor-infiltrating CD8+ T cells, CD133+ CSCs, and CK19+ TB.

Characterization of the Spatial Immune Context of Lung Cancer
International Journal of Molecular Sciences

In a recent study, Imamura et al. investigated the role of debrin-expressing tumor infiltration lymphocytes (TIL) in lung cancer. The high-end image analysis solution, StrataQuest, was used for the automatic tissue classification and localization of CD3+/debrin+ cellular phenotypes in the tumor cell nest, as well as in the stroma.

COL8A1 Promotes Tumor in Pancreatic Ductal Adenocarcinoma
Matrix Biology

Yan et al. investigated several collagen subtypes involved in p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ma desmoplasia. Based on this study, COL8A1 was suggested as a new marker for predicting poor chemotherapy responsiveness and survival. The TissueFAXS imaging platform and StrataQuest analysis solution were used to image and segment morphological structures.

Erk1/2-Dependent HNSCC Cell Susceptibility to Erastin-Induced Ferroptosis
cells

Savic et al. investigated the Erk 1/2 pathway role in ferroptosis induction by targeting xCT protein during the treatment of HNSCC. They found erastin to be a potent ferroptosis inducer which is strongly dependent on Erk 1/2 kinases. TissueFAXS and HistoQuest were used to image the IHC-stained samples and calculate the percentage of xCT-positive cells.

Temporal changes in T cell subsets and expansion of cytotoxic CD4+ T cells in the lungs in severe COVID-19
Clinical Immunology

Kaneko et al. published a study in the Clinical Immunology journal focusing on the quantitative analysis of T-cell subset alterations in thoracic lymph nodes and lung samples of COVID-19 patients. With the help of TissueFAXS and StrataQuest, the authors were first to show the expansion of cytotoxic CD4+ T cells in the lungs of patients with severe COVID-19.
